With a DMP, you make one regular monthly repayment to the credit report therapy company. Those funds are then distributed to lenders of your unprotected financial obligations, such as charge card and installment car loans. The firm collaborates with your creditors to decrease interest rates or waive charges, but some creditors might refuse such giving ins.
A debt consolidation finance combines your eligible debts into one new funding. It can assist you pay for debt if you're able to secure a funding price that's lower than the typical price of the accounts you're combining. The letter could prove you do not owe what the debt collector's records reveal. Yes, for the most part, the IRS considers forgiven financial obligation as taxed earnings. When a lending institution forgives $600 or more, they are called for to send you Type 1099-C.
Debt forgiveness or settlement usually injures your credit history. Anytime you work out a debt for much less than you owe, it may look like "worked out" on your debt record and affect your credit rating for seven years from the day of settlement. Your credit score can also drop considerably in the months bring about the forgiveness if you fall back on settlements.
Tax obligation financial debt compromise programs Tax financial obligation occurs when the quantity of tax obligations you owe exceeds what you have paid. This circumstance commonly arises from underreporting earnings, not filing returns on time, or inconsistencies located during an IRS audit. The effects of collecting tax financial debt are severe and can include tax liens, which offer the IRS a legal case to your building as safety for the financial obligation.

The application process for a Deal in Compromise entails several detailed steps. You need to finish and submit Internal revenue service Kind 656, the Offer in Compromise application, and Type 433-A (OIC), a collection details declaration for individuals. These forms call for detailed monetary info, consisting of information concerning your earnings, financial obligations, costs, and assets.
Back taxes, which are unsettled tax obligations from previous years, can considerably increase your complete internal revenue service debt if not resolved immediately. This debt can accumulate passion and late repayment penalties, making the initial amount owed much bigger over time. Failure to repay tax obligations can cause the internal revenue service taking enforcement activities, such as providing a tax obligation lien or levy against your home.
It is very important to deal with back taxes as soon as feasible, either by paying the sum total owed or by preparing a layaway plan with the IRS. By taking aggressive steps, you can stay clear of the build-up of additional rate of interest and charges, and stop more hostile collection activities by the internal revenue service.
